Unboxing Your Hp Envy 6455e 2026

Begin by carefully removing the printer from its packaging. Ensure all accessories such as power cords, ink cartridges, and user manuals are included. Place the printer on a flat, stable surface near a power outlet.

Initial Setup and Power Connection

Connect the power cord to the back of the printer and plug it into an electrical outlet. Press the power button to turn on your Hp Envy 6455e 2026. The initial startup screen will appear on the control panel.

Installing Ink Cartridges

Open the ink cartridge access door. Remove the new cartridges from their packaging, then insert and snap them into the correct color slots. Close the access door securely.

Loading Paper

Pull out the input tray and load standard or photo paper, adjusting the paper guides to fit the stack. Reinsert the tray into the printer.

Connecting to Wi-Fi

On the printer control panel, select the Wi-Fi icon. Choose your Wi-Fi network from the list and enter the password. Wait for the connection confirmation.

Using the HP Smart App

Download the HP Smart app on your smartphone or tablet. Follow the in-app instructions to connect your printer and perform firmware updates if prompted.

Performing a Test Print

Once connected, navigate to the printer menu and select the ‘Print Test Page’ option. Confirm that the test page prints correctly, indicating your setup is complete.

Troubleshooting Tips

  • If the printer does not turn on, check the power connection.
  • Ensure the ink cartridges are installed properly.
  • Verify Wi-Fi connection stability if unable to connect.
  • Refer to the user manual for error messages or blinking lights.
